REGULATION OF LEGAL PROTECTION AGAINST TOURISTS AND IMPLEMENTATION OF CRIMINAL SANCTIONS AGAINST THE ACT OF AGAINST THE LAW ACCORDING TO LAW NUMBER 10 OF 2009 ON TOURISM
I KETUT SUGIARTHA S.H.,M.Kn

Universitas Warmadewa


Abstract

This study aims to determine the legal protection for tourists according to Law No. 10 of 2009 concerning the implementation of criminal sanctions against tourism. against the law against part or all of the physical tourist attraction according to Law Number 10 of 2009 concerning Tourism. The type of research used is normative research or library research.
Based on the description above, it can be concluded as follows. According to Article 62 of Law Number 8 of 1999 concerning Consumer Protection, it is stated that the losses suffered by tourists caused by human error which in this case were carried out by tour guides and other staff are acts against the law as regulated in Article 1365 of the Civil Code. The law provides legal protection for those who are harmed by demanding the party causing the loss to provide compensation to tourists who have suffered losses for the travel agent as the organizer (producer) is obliged to provide legal protection and provide trust for the services that have been provided. According to Law Number 10 of 2009 concerning Tourism, Article 64 paragraph 1 and paragraph 2 states that (1) Anyone who intentionally and against the law damages the physical tourist attraction as referred to in Article 27 shall be punished with imprisonment for a maximum of 7 years. (seven) years and a maximum fine of Rp. 10,000,000,000.00 (ten billion rupiah). (2) Any person who due to negligence and against the law, physically damages, or reduces the value of a tourist attraction as referred to in Article 27 shall be sentenced to a maximum imprisonment of 1 (one) year and/or a maximum fine of Rp. 5,000,000,000.00 (five billion rupiah)
